BIODEGRADABLE AND BIOINSPIRED POLYMERS FOR PHARMACEUTICAL FORMULATIONS AND DRUG DELIVERY: A BRIEF REVIEW
1University Department of Pharmaceutical Sciences, Utkal University,Vani Vihar, India. 2Jeypore College of Pharmacy, Rondapalli, Jeypore, Koraput,Odisha. India.
Abstract The knowledge and skill in the area of biodegradable polymer technology is expanding rapidly. This cutting edge technology has generated a substantial number of biodegradable polymers with a wide range of degradation rates. This has widened the horizon of the option that researchers have at their disposal for controlled and targeted delivery of a whole array of therapeutic moieties .Needless to say that in the recent years the application of biodegradable and environmentally sensitive polymers in drug delivery system has reached dizzy heights. Biospecific polymer and copolymers having suitable chemical groups and or functional monomers have been synthesized. The individual classes of polymers in the family of biodegradable polymers have their distinct characteristics in terms of biodegradation, biocompatibility, stability and versatility, and thus their application potential for various delivery applications through different routes of administration in interplay of these factors. Advances in supramolecular chemistry that allow us to use noncovalent bonds to fabricate well defined and well organized materials. This part-I review provides a short overview of important research on the synthesis and applications of biodegradable and bioinspired polymers and gels for pharmaceutical formulations and drug delivery.
